Understanding Surface Compatibility for Suction
Suction works on the principle of a vacuum seal, which requires a perfectly smooth, non-porous surface. Most RV countertops—often made of laminate, faux-stone, or lightweight composite—are ideal. However, if your table has a textured wood grain or a matte finish, the suction will fail every time.
Before you invest, perform the "water test" on your dining surface. If a standard suction cup doesn’t hold firm on your table, you may need to add a thin, smooth placemat or a tempered glass topper to create the necessary seal. Don’t fight the surface; adapt your setup to match the physics of the suction.

Tips for Maintaining Strong Suction Power
Even the best suction plate will fail if the surface is dirty. Always wipe your table down with a damp cloth to remove dust or invisible grease before applying the suction. A clean, slightly damp surface creates a much stronger vacuum seal than a dry, dusty one.
If the suction cup loses its shape over time, try soaking it in very hot water for a few minutes to restore its flexibility.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ive sponges, as these can scratch the surface and ruin the seal. Treat your suction gear with care, and it will keep your meals grounded for years.
